/*
================================================
idMenuWidget

We're using a model/view architecture, so this is the combination of both model and view.  The
other part of the view is the SWF itself.
================================================
*/
class idMenuWidget
{
public:

	/*
	================================================
	WrapWidgetSWFEvent
	================================================
	*/
	class WrapWidgetSWFEvent : public idSWFScriptFunction_RefCounted
	{
	public:
		WrapWidgetSWFEvent( idMenuWidget* widget, const widgetEvent_t event, const int eventArg ) :
			targetWidget( widget ),
			targetEvent( event ),
			targetEventArg( eventArg )
		{
		}
		
		idSWFScriptVar Call( idSWFScriptObject* thisObject, const idSWFParmList& parms )
		{
			targetWidget->ReceiveEvent( idWidgetEvent( targetEvent, targetEventArg, thisObject, parms ) );
			return idSWFScriptVar();
		}
		
	private:
		idMenuWidget* 	targetWidget;
		widgetEvent_t	targetEvent;
		int				targetEventArg;
	};
	
	
	enum widgetState_t
	{
		WIDGET_STATE_HIDDEN,	// hidden
		WIDGET_STATE_NORMAL,	// normal
		WIDGET_STATE_SELECTING,	// going into the selected state
		WIDGET_STATE_SELECTED,	// fully selected
		WIDGET_STATE_DISABLED,	// disabled
		WIDGET_STATE_MAX
	};
	
	idMenuWidget();
	
	virtual								~idMenuWidget();
	
	void								Cleanup();
	// typically this is where the allocations for a widget will occur: sub widgets, etc.
	// Note that SWF sprite objects may not be accessible at this point.
	virtual void						Initialize( idMenuHandler* data )
	{
		menuData = data;
	}
	
	// takes the information described in this widget and applies it to a given script object.
	// the script object should point to the root that you want to run from. Running this will
	// also create the sprite binding, if any.
	virtual void						Update() {}
	virtual void						Show();
	virtual void						Hide();
	
	widgetState_t						GetState() const
	{
		return widgetState;
	}
	void								SetState( const widgetState_t state );
	
	// actually binds the sprite. this must be called after setting sprite path!
	idSWFSpriteInstance* 				GetSprite()
	{
		return boundSprite;
	}
	idSWF* 								GetSWFObject();
	idMenuHandler* 						GetMenuData();
	bool								BindSprite( idSWFScriptObject& root );
	void								ClearSprite();
	
	void								SetSpritePath( const char* arg1, const char* arg2 = NULL, const char* arg3 = NULL, const char* arg4 = NULL, const char* arg5 = NULL );
	void								SetSpritePath( const idList< idStr >& spritePath_, const char* arg1 = NULL, const char* arg2 = NULL, const char* arg3 = NULL, const char* arg4 = NULL, const char* arg5 = NULL );
	idList< idStr, TAG_IDLIB_LIST_MENU >& 					GetSpritePath()
	{
		return spritePath;
	}
	int									GetRefCount() const
	{
		return refCount;
	}
	void						AddRef()
	{
		refCount++;
	}
	void						Release()
	{
		assert( refCount > 0 );
		if( --refCount == 0 && !noAutoFree )
		{
			delete this;
		}
	}
	
	//------------------------
	// Event Handling
	//------------------------
	virtual bool						HandleAction( idWidgetAction& action, const idWidgetEvent& event, idMenuWidget* widget, bool forceHandled = false );
	virtual void						ObserveEvent( const idMenuWidget& widget, const idWidgetEvent& event ) { }
	void								SendEventToObservers( const idWidgetEvent& event );
	void								RegisterEventObserver( idMenuWidget* observer );
	void								ReceiveEvent( const idWidgetEvent& event );
	
	// Executes an event in the context of this widget.  Only rarely should this be called
	// directly.  Instead calls should go through ReceiveEvent which will propagate the event
	// through the standard focus order.
	virtual bool						ExecuteEvent( const idWidgetEvent& event );
	
	// returns the list of actions for a given event, or NULL if no actions are registered for
	// that event.  Events should not be directly added to the returned list.  Instead use
	// AddEventAction for adding new events.
	idList< idWidgetAction, TAG_IDLIB_LIST_MENU >* 			GetEventActions( const widgetEvent_t eventType );
	
	// allocates an action for the given event
	idWidgetAction& 					AddEventAction( const widgetEvent_t eventType );
	void								ClearEventActions();
	
	//------------------------
	// Data modeling
	//------------------------
	void								SetDataSource( idMenuDataSource* dataSource, const int fieldIndex );
	idMenuDataSource* 					GetDataSource()
	{
		return dataSource;
	}
	void								SetDataSourceFieldIndex( const int dataSourceFieldIndex_ )
	{
		dataSourceFieldIndex = dataSourceFieldIndex_;
	}
	int									GetDataSourceFieldIndex() const
	{
		return dataSourceFieldIndex;
	}
	
	idMenuWidget* 						GetFocus()
	{
		return ( focusIndex >= 0 && focusIndex < children.Num() ) ? children[ focusIndex ] : NULL;
	}
	int									GetFocusIndex() const
	{
		return focusIndex;
	}
	void								SetFocusIndex( const int index, bool skipSound = false );
	
	//------------------------
	// Hierarchy
	//------------------------
	idMenuWidgetList& 					GetChildren()
	{
		return children;
	}
	const idMenuWidgetList& 			GetChildren() const
	{
		return children;
	}
	idMenuWidget& 						GetChildByIndex( const int index ) const
	{
		return *children[ index ];
	}
	
	void								AddChild( idMenuWidget* widget );
	void								RemoveChild( idMenuWidget* widget );
	bool								HasChild( idMenuWidget* widget );
	void								RemoveAllChildren();
	
	idMenuWidget* 						GetParent()
	{
		return parent;
	}
	const idMenuWidget* 				GetParent() const
	{
		return parent;
	}
	void								SetParent( idMenuWidget* parent_ )
	{
		parent = parent_;
	}
	void								SetSWFObj( idSWF* obj )
	{
		swfObj = obj;
	}
	bool								GetHandlerIsParent()
	{
		return handlerIsParent;
	}
	void								SetHandlerIsParent( bool val )
	{
		handlerIsParent = val;
	}
	void								SetNoAutoFree( bool b )
	{
		noAutoFree = b;
	}
	
protected:
	void								ForceFocusIndex( const int index )
	{
		focusIndex = index;
	}
	
protected:
	bool								handlerIsParent;
	idMenuHandler* 						menuData;
	idSWF* 								swfObj;
	idSWFSpriteInstance* 				boundSprite;
	idMenuWidget* 						parent;
	idList< idStr, TAG_IDLIB_LIST_MENU >						spritePath;
	idMenuWidgetList											children;
	idMenuWidgetList											observers;
	
	static const int INVALID_ACTION_INDEX = -1;
	idList< idList< idWidgetAction, TAG_IDLIB_LIST_MENU >, TAG_IDLIB_LIST_MENU >		eventActions;
	idStaticList< int, MAX_WIDGET_EVENT >	eventActionLookup;
	
	idMenuDataSource* 					dataSource;
	int									dataSourceFieldIndex;
	
	int									focusIndex;
	
	widgetState_t						widgetState;
	int									refCount;
	bool								noAutoFree;
};
